Phlebotomy salary and jobs in Washington

There’s a higher than average demand for phlebotomists throughout the United States and in Washington. The Bureau of Labor Statistics expects a 25% growth in new job opportunities across the country and 25% in the State of Washington through 2024. Below is a listing of the major metropolitan areas in Washington and more data on phlebotomy compensation by location and county.

LocationPay TypeLowMedianHigh
United StatesHourly$11.22$15.72$22.52
Yearly$23,330$32,710$46,850
WashingtonHourly$13.31$17.47$23.21
Yearly$27,690$36,340$48,280
Portland-Vancouver-Hillsboro, OR-WA MSAHourly$13.83$18.56$23.61
Yearly$28,760$38,600$49,110
Seattle-Bellevue-Everett, WA Metropolitan DivisionHourly$14.34$17.96$23.60
Yearly$29,840$37,350$49,090
Mount Vernon-Anacortes, WA MSAHourly$13.80$17.93$24.69
Yearly$28,700$37,300$51,360
Southwestern Washington BOSHourly$15.45$17.79$22.93
Yearly$32,130$36,990$47,700
Bremerton-Silverdale, WA MSAHourly$13.88$17.38$21.25
Yearly$28,860$36,150$44,190
Tacoma, WA Metropolitan DivisionHourly$13.36$17.38$23.17
Yearly$27,780$36,160$48,180
Spokane, WA MSAHourly$12.30$15.80$21.57
Yearly$25,590$32,870$44,860
Kennewick-Pasco-Richland, WA MSAHourly$12.78$15.35$21.11
Yearly$26,590$31,920$43,900
Yakima, WA MSAHourly$12.70$14.97$19.82
Yearly$26,420$31,130$41,230
